Satellite communication has come a long way since its experimental beginnings, evolving into a sophisticated global network that plays a crucial role in modern telecommunications. The journey of non-terrestrial networks (NTNs) is marked by significant milestones, particularly the transition from geostationary (GEO) satellites to medium Earth orbit (MEO) and low Earth orbit (LEO) constellations. This evolution not only highlights the advancements in satellite technology but also underscores the promise of LEO constellations in providing mobile broadband services on a global scale.

This eBook examines the evolution of Non-Terrestrial Networks (NTNs), compares GEO, MEO, and LEO satellite architectures, and highlights how LEO constellations are poised to redefine global mobile connectivity.
